
Great success on a busy morning! I found a convenient item at Daiso, a 100-yen shop, that shortens the time for making bento boxes, so I bought it.

"Frozen side dish case No. 6" is a side dish case in which the remaining side dishes can be divided into cups and stored frozen. It is convenient for freezing the leftover side dishes of supper and filling them in a lunch box, or for pre-prepared storage.

Let's actually use the side dishes frozen in this case for lunch. Put a side dish cup (sold separately) in the case and fill it with the side dishes you want to freeze. The side dish case I bought is for No. 6, so I used the No. 6 cup.




The next morning, fill the bento box with the frozen side dishes. The side dishes inside are frozen according to the shape of the case, so it's easy to pick up with chopsticks and it's easy to pack in a bento.


I packed side dishes around 9 am and kept my lunch in the refrigerator during the day, but it was thawed well around noon. It can be packed frozen, so it can be used as an ice pack.


In a busy morning, using the "frozen side dish case" makes making lunch faster and easier. There are two case sizes, one for No. 6 and one for No. 8, so choose the one that fits your lunch box. The price is 108 yen (tax included) per piece.
